在某些情况下是否可以不通过safeArgs

时间:2020-07-04 19:00:17

标签: android android-fragments android-jetpack-navigation android-safe-args

我正在开发必须实现添加和编辑功能的应用程序。 我正在使用一个片段,我正在向该片段传递一个safearg,该片段对于编辑模式可以正常工作 我传递了args,但是由于添加模式而崩溃,因为这一次我没有传递任何参数。 是否可以不根据条件传递参数?

1 个答案:

答案 0 :(得分:0)

为参数添加一个空值。然后在“编辑并添加”屏幕中,检查是否为空。如果value为null,则为Add。如果不为null,则为修改。